Another MD mom here - residency schedules are set a year in advance and need to be coordinated between a variety of services through which residents rotate during their training. The only thing that is not scheduled far in advance is call - and that is where the pregnant resident screwed her colleagues over by not announcing her pregnancy earlier. Chances are, she will not be able to take call in the last trimester and her fellow residents will have to take on extra call or her. The honorable thing to do would be to take extra call early in the pregnancy, to even thing out. By not doing that, she is basically sticking her colleagues (who also have lives of their own) with a ton of extra work that she will never make up to them. That's a shitty thing to do, sorry. As a resident in a competitive specialty ( DH is a surgery resident as well) who is currently pregnant hopefully I can provide another perspective. Pregnancy is not always something you can plan to perfectly accomodate co-residents schedules: We initially tried to time a pregnancy to have a baby while I was on a research year and then ended up dealing with 3 years of infertility..miscarriages etc. and are now dealing with 2 weeks off (DH will get no time off) after giving birth and lots of snark regarding why we chose to have a baby during such a busy year. The lack of compassion for pregnant residents has really surprised me..I've even known some pressured to terminate by their program. You shouldn't be upset at her but rather the system in general. It shouldn't be that residents are so overextended and overworked as it is that the loss of one causes such problems. Programs need to have better systems in place for these situations (not just pregnancy but serious illnesses etc among housestaff) and better ancillary support. [ Reply | More ]

MD pregnant mom here... I took time off before kids (PhD) so I'm on the older side of things. Having seen pregnancies done the 'right' and 'wrong' way through residencies my conclusion is that the system is just poorly designed. All residencies should be designed for education primarily - that's why the US gov pays hospitals for residency costs - even if many programs would not survive without scut. But by making these programs service heavy with no slack, I think that it forces women to police and judge each other. Have I judged about the same thing? Sure. Did I wait until after residency for my second? Sure. But the fact that half of doctors are women of reproductive age - and that residency programs have no contingency programs - is something that annoys the heck out of me. And about the 4 month mark... Yeah I was terrified of telling my PD that I was pregnant. Thank God my PD is nice (and a woman, although I guess that doesn't go hand in hand).... Ok rant over... [ Reply | More ]
